Include keywords. Today, many employers filter and rank resumes using applicant tracking systems (ATS) that scan them for relevant keywords. WebKeep it interesting, and they may just keep reading the rest of your resume to see why you’re deserving of an interview. Start each sentence or bullet point with an action verb. Words like “implemented,” “pioneered,” “spearheaded,” and “optimized” capture attention and breathe life into your resume. Show, don’t tell.

WebStudy the job description and make a note of or underline any important skill-related keywords. These might be terms or expressions that appear specific to the position or are used often in the job posting.
